Does anyone ever hop into their sierra in a hurry and find that they need to wrench the seatbelt from underneath their own weight? I was just wondering if anyone had found a solution to this problem. When I bought my sierra, it had a retractable seatbelt from another car (which I do not know...) however it always got stuck when pulling it (due to the angle it was on ...)
Did anyone have a common type seatbelt from another make/ model car that would easily bolt into a sierra? I would like to possible get one from the wreckers.
you can get universal retractable seatbelts from auto shops like supercheap. i have looked into doing this myself but got sidetracked with doing an engine conversion.
ive got 60 series cruiser, came with a angle bracket which you can eather bolt down the bottom of the wheel wheel behind the seat, or mod it to bolt throught the floor.

I got a one size fits all from Auto-one. They were about $90 and the brand is Klippax-----I think. I got the model from another post here but I can't find it now.
Found it. It's a Klippan K4546 with a 350mm stalk. You can go a smaller stalk if required. It's a bit of mucking around to fit but alot better than before.
NIK wrote:If your after retractable seat belts get widetrack sierra ones bolt straight in and because they where standard on w/t they look standard on n/t.
